SEASON 2013-14
BIG DEAL WITH VODAFONE
20.08.2013
Beşiktaş JK and Vodafone have signed a $145 million deal that includes naming rights to the club's new stadium (for 15 years) and jersey advertisements (for 5 years). The demolition of the old stadium began on June 2.
A GOOD START
18.08.2013
The Black Eagles won the first match of the season 2-0 against Trabzonspor. Olcay and Gökhan scored the goals in front of their 50,000 supporters in Atatürk Olympic Stadium.
WELCOME BILIĆ
26.06.2013
The former Croatia national team coach Slaven Bilić has agreed three-year Beşiktaş deal. The 44-year-old coach was in charge of Lokomotiv Moscow last season.
UEFA BANS BEŞİKTAŞ
25.06.2013
UEFA have pronounced that Beşiktaş is not eligible to participate in the 2013-14 Europa League due to the match-fixing scandal in 2010-11 Turkish Cup final. UEFA have also banned the rivals Fenerbahçe from next two season's European competitions.
ORMAN RE-ELECTED
16.06.2013
Beşiktaş JK president Fikret Orman won the election against Serdal Adalı. Mr. Orman had received 1762 votes more than his opponent. There were a total of 5940 electors.
THANK YOU CAPTAIN
23.05.2013
The Beşiktaş board decided not to continue with coach Samet Aybaba next season. The 58 years old trainer was also a former captain of Beşiktaş.

JK, founded in 1903, is Turkey's first sports club. The colors of the
club are black and white. The club's nickname is The Black Eagles.
Beşiktaş JK is the only Turkish club in history which has played as a
national football team. Therefore Beşiktaş JK had gained the right to use the
Turkish flag in its emblem. The club's football team is the best team in
Turkey. The home ground of Beşiktaş JK is the beautiful İnönü Stadium
with a 32,786 seating capacity. It is located by the Bosphorus,
near the Dolmabahçe Palace.
